Dawn breaks pale over the Crianlarich peaks, and from your pod window or guesthouse room the light spills across bracken and pine, silent except for the occasional bleat from the hillside above.

This is a handy base for walkers tackling the West Highland Way or bagging Munros—Ben More and Stob Binnein loom close—and the mix of camping pods and guest house rooms means groups or families can pick their comfort level. Dogs are welcome by arrangement, so fell-bound hounds and their humans are well looked after. The location puts you right in the heart of the southern Highlands, where serious hill country meets the quiet drama of Loch Lomond and the Trossachs.

Facilities aren't detailed, so it's worth asking ahead what's provided in the pods versus the main house. Campfires need checking on arrival—it'll depend on conditions and where you're pitched. Year-round opening makes this a solid winter bolt-hole as much as a summer hillwalking stop. Quiet, unpretentious, mountain-close.

West Highland Way (Inverarnan to Tyndrum)

Traces Glen Falloch's riverside path before climbing steadily through Crianlarich and ascending moorland to Tyndrum—expect moderate inclines with some steep sections. Not suitable for buggies or very young children due to length, uneven terrain and boggy patches. Dogs welcome but keep on leads near sheep. Rewards with dramatic Highland scenery, waterfalls, and genuine wilderness atmosphere on this iconic long-distance trail section.

West Highland Way (Tyndrum to Inveroran)

Follows an old military road through classic Highland scenery with moderate, steady climbs and long descents across open moorland. The 14.5km stretch is too long and remote for young children or buggies—terrain is rough underfoot with boggy sections after rain. Dogs welcome but keep under control around grazing sheep. Delivers big skies, mountain views towards Bridge of Orchy, and a genuine sense of wilderness between these two remote settlements.

Bridge of Orchy to Auch (On WHW)

Climbs steadily from Bridge of Orchy through open moorland with a punchy ascent towards the summit, though nothing too technical underfoot. The gradient makes this challenging for young children and definitely not buggy-friendly. Dogs are welcome on leads where sheep graze. Rewards walkers with sweeping Highland views across Rannoch Moor and glimpses of distant peaks – classic West Highland Way scenery that captures Scotland's wild beauty perfectly.
